B&R Automation, a subsidiary of ABB, is a global leader in industrial automation technology. Founded in 1979 in Austria, B&R provides inn...

B&R Automation, a subsidiary of ABB, is a global leader in industrial automation technology. Founded in 1979 in Austria, B&R provides innovative solutions for machine and factory automation, combining advanced hardware and software. Its product range includes programmable logic controllers (PLCs), industrial PCs, servo drives, and advanced motion control systems. Known for its Automation Studio software, B&R enables seamless integration and high efficiency in manufacturing processes. The company's focus on flexibility, scalability, and open standards makes it a trusted partner for industries such as packaging, automotive, food and beverage, and energy systems worldwide.

Bosch Rexroth has a rich history that evolved through multiple mergers over many years. Founded in 1958 in Neuwied, Germany, Indramat spe...

Bosch Rexroth has a rich history that evolved through multiple mergers over many years. Founded in 1958 in Neuwied, Germany, Indramat specialized in industrial motion control, offering products such as servo drives, servo motors, and servo controllers for diverse manufacturing applications. In 1965, Rexroth, another prominent German company, acquired Indramat, leading to the formation of Rexroth Indramat. A significant milestone came in 1979 when Indramat introduced their AC brushless servo motor. In 2001, Robert Bosch GmbH acquired Rexroth Indramat, and the company was rebranded as Bosch Rexroth. Today, Bosch Rexroth stands as a global leader in drive and control technologies, boasting a unique heritage spanning over 200 years. For cutting-edge technology in automation and industrial solutions, Bosch Rexroth remains at the forefront.

Since 1985, Copley Controls has continually advanced servo drive technology, evolving from a small manufacturer of analog servo amplifier...

Since 1985, Copley Controls has continually advanced servo drive technology, evolving from a small manufacturer of analog servo amplifiers into a prominent leader in digital motion control. Headquartered in Canton, Massachusetts, Copley earned its reputation through expertly engineered, compact, high-performance servo drives. A significant milestone was their creation of space-efficient designs without sacrificing power, exemplified by their well-known Xenus and Accelnet series. Today, Copley Controls supports diverse sectors, including medical device manufacturing and semiconductor production, particularly excelling in applications requiring both precision and compact size. Their servo drives power laboratory instruments, automated production systems, and sophisticated machinery worldwide.

Founded in 1933, Danfoss originated in Nordborg, Denmark, where its founder Mads Clausen began experimenting with expansion valves for re...

Founded in 1933, Danfoss originated in Nordborg, Denmark, where its founder Mads Clausen began experimenting with expansion valves for refrigeration systems. Over the decades, Danfoss has grown into a global leader, setting standards in various industries. The company manufactures a diverse range of products serving multiple markets, including refrigeration, heating, electric motor control, and energy metering. Among their offerings, Danfoss is renowned for their AC Drives, featuring the compact VLT Micro Drive FC 51, ideal for space-efficient installations. Their motor families exemplify flexibility, quality, efficiency, and reliability, consistently meeting industry demands.

Founded by Karl-Ernst Brinkmann in 1972, KEB initially specialized in motor braking and electromagnetic couplings. Known for their reliab...

Founded by Karl-Ernst Brinkmann in 1972, KEB initially specialized in motor braking and electromagnetic couplings. Known for their reliability and competitive pricing, KEB quickly expanded their product range into motion control and servo motors by the mid-1990s. Today, KEB offers a comprehensive lineup of industrial automation components, including HMI units, software platforms, control modules, servo drives, and AC/DC motors. KEB products are esteemed for their seamless integration into various automation systems and environments. Manufactured in Germany, KEB parts uphold the reputation of dependable and rigorously tested German engineering.

Founded in 1898 by Eiichi Okuma in Nagoya, Japan, Okuma Noodle Machine Co. initially manufactured noodle-making machines. Displeased with...

Founded in 1898 by Eiichi Okuma in Nagoya, Japan, Okuma Noodle Machine Co. initially manufactured noodle-making machines. Displeased with the quality of lathes available in Japan, Okuma pivoted to designing and producing machine tools. In 1918, Eiichi established Okuma Machinery Works Ltd. and introduced the OS lathe. With over a century of history and expertise, Okuma has become a global leader and innovator in machine tools, particularly lathes. Their CNC machine tools span lathes, machining centers, multitasking machines, and grinding machines, offering customers precision and reliability they can trust.

Founded in 1919 in Rockford, Illinois, Pacific Scientific initially focused on manufacturing generators, motors, and alternators. Over th...

Founded in 1919 in Rockford, Illinois, Pacific Scientific initially focused on manufacturing generators, motors, and alternators. Over the decades, it expanded into diverse sectors including Armament, Aerospace, and industrial divisions. In 1998, Pacific Scientific was acquired by Danaher Corp., broadening its reach and capabilities in automation equipment. Pacific Scientific's portfolio includes AC & DC servo motors, servo drives, and other automation solutions that have been widely adopted in packaging and printing operations globally. While the company has shifted focus towards defense technologies such as energetic materials, ordinances, and lasers, its legacy automation products remain available through custom orders and sourcing networks worldwide.

Founded in 1927, Sanyo Denki began as a Japanese import company specializing in electrical components. Over the years, it has grown into ...

Founded in 1927, Sanyo Denki began as a Japanese import company specializing in electrical components. Over the years, it has grown into a global manufacturer known for its servo systems, power systems, and cooling systems. Sanyo Denki's AC servo systems encompass closed-loop step systems, 5-phase step systems, 2-phase step systems, and motion control solutions. Their power systems range from Hybrid/Small UPS to Large UPS and Network Power Managers, incorporating advanced technologies for enhanced performance response, eco-friendly efficiency, reduced noise, and over-current protection measures.

Globally recognized, Vickers supplies power and motion control systems and components for industrial, aerospace, marine, and mobile appli...

Globally recognized, Vickers supplies power and motion control systems and components for industrial, aerospace, marine, and mobile applications. Their products include vane and piston pumps, valves, hydraulic controls, power amplifier cards, and more. Vickers also pioneered the industry's first fluid analysis service, still widely used today. Known for their reliability and performance, Vickers remains a top choice for hydraulic solutions in competitive industries worldwide.
